  8. 20 hours ago, Honey Little said:

    Doesn’t London have a curfew? I am worried that the shows will be cut short or canceled due to curfew laws in London.

    The O2 is not in a residential area and does not have a legal curfew despite the urban legends you may read online.

    Each promoter can set a "latest finish time" with the venue to make sure that staff are booked to stay - ive been to a number of O2 events this year that have gone on well past midnight / towards 1am. Indeed, some other events (e.g. DJs) go well into the early hours of the morning at venues like The O2, IndigO2 and Wembley Arena. I had a good chat with a colleague who works there about it all.

    Even if they run over the "latest finish time", the staff will stay, and the promoter just pays a fine (e.g. when Justin Bieber didn't come on until 10.45pm and finished at 12:30am, the promoter just paid a fine).

    Interestingly Madonna went past 11pm on her second Rebel Heart show at The O2 and the screens got switched on advertising the final tube times at midnight whilst she was singing Holiday.

    The only venue in London that "pulls the plug" as far as I know it is Hyde Park, at 10.35pm. Thats not to say it couldn't happen at The O2 if she runs well over the agreed latest finish time / something like Rebel Heart Glasgow happens where its her sound team (rather than the venue) which close down early - but to my knowledge its not happened to date since The O2 opened.
